The Stag first opened its’ doors in 1874. Mr George Wadley was the Stag’s first landlord & ran the public house for 17 years. G Wadley’s Upstairs is an intimate, 40 seat restaurant and roof terrace, serving classic dishes and old fashioned British starters and puddings.
Winston Churchill was born in the same year the Stag was opened in 1874. Sir Winston Leonard Spencer was not only an inspirational leader, he also loved his favourite tipples. In fact his love of After, Between & Before dinner drinking made him a true connoisseur. We stock his favourite Champagne, Cigar, Cognac & Whisky. His love of these particular brands came from extensive research & he made sure all British embassies around the globe were stocked up, pending his potential visit. He was very particular about his favourites & tested them all to great length. For example, he was known to go through 9 bottles of Pol Roger on a steady Saturday. He lived to a happy 90.
